Sour cream dressing for salads

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• 1 cup sour cream (200 g)
  • 2 dashes citric acid
  • some vinegar essence
  • 4 drops of sweetener
  • Salt and pepper, black
  • some milk

Instructions

Working time approx. 5 minutes; Total time approx. 5 minutes

Combine 1 cup of sour cream with citric acid, vinegar essence, sweetener, salt, and black pepper. If the sour cream is too thick, add enough milk until the dressing is slightly creamy. I like to add freshly ground black pepper for a better flavor. The dressing has a slightly sweet and sour taste.
